Factory | Number |
---|---|
LUCAS ... | lrs1164 |
CASCO | CST20117 |
YANMAR | 114399-77010 |
PowerSport | RF90716562 |
HOLGER... | 112478 |
HC-PARTS | 112478 |
USA In... | 18203 |
Descripition:
Brand:LUCAS ELECTRICAL
Part Number(s):LRS1164
ProductName:Starter
DOYEN 35050597 Clutch Cable
POWERPART PMFL246 Oil Filter
LUCAS ELECTRICAL 6113692 Disc Brake Pad Set
OMG 2337 Tie Rod End
MAPCO 19025 Track Control Arm
JAPANPARTS CS-814 Wheel Brake Cylinder
JAPANPARTS GF-K03AF Brake Shoe Set
HELLA 8PZ 010 090-051 Adapter Cable, self-diagnosis unit
VALEO 350614 Master Cylinder Brakes
FERRARI 7588802 Coolant Temperature Sensor
WALKER 15141 Universal Converter
NAPA 1-5141 TRANSMISSION FILTER